Synthesis and crystal structure of a new coordination polymer based on lanthanum and 1,4-phenylenediacetate ligands
Abstract
Reaction in gel between the sodium salt of 1,4-phenyl-enedi-acetic acid (NaCOH-Na -pda) and lanthanum chloride yields single crystals of the three-dimensional coordination polymer poly[[tetra-aqua-tris-(μ-1,4-phenyl-enedi-acetato)-dilanthanum(III)] octa-hydrate], {[La(CHO)(HO)]·8HO}. The La coordination polyhedron can be described as a slightly distorted monocapped square anti-prism. One of the two -pda ligands is bound to four La ions and the other to two La ions. Each La atom is coordinated by five ligands, thereby generating a metal-organic framework with potential porosity properties.
